About the Event

Since its inception in modern form, after a grand opening by the late Queen Elizabeth II in 1992, Metrolink has come a long way. With 7 destination, 106 stops and a fleet of 147 vehicles, technology has played a pivotal role in the development of the largest tram system in the country.

The North West & Wales Area Council is delighted to offer members to a behind-the-scenes insight into training and maintenance at Metrolink Queens Road depot. After visiting the wheel lathe and guided tour of bogie workshop, members will be given the opportunity to be a driver in the latest, realistic tram simulator to drive on a chosen route.
